NACUBO 2026 Annual Meeting

The NACUBO 2026 Annual Meeting is the largest gathering for higher education business officers, offering sessions on operational strategy, financial sustainability, analytics, AI, governance, leadership, and more. The event features diverse sessions, keynotes by leaders in academia and policy, constituent roundtables, specialized networking, and a vibrant ex…
